French drain installation is a practical solution designed to help manage excess water around a property’s foundation and landscape. This service involves digging a trench, typically sloped to direct water away from the building, and installing a perforated pipe surrounded by gravel or rock. The system works by collecting groundwater or surface runoff and channeling it away from areas where standing water or flooding can cause damage. Properly installed French drains can prevent water from seeping into basements, crawl spaces, or low-lying yard areas, helping to maintain a dry and stable property environment.
Many property owners seek French drain installation to address common drainage issues such as persistent soggy lawns, pooling water after rain, or water infiltration into basements. These problems often result from poor soil drainage, improper grading, or high water tables. Installing a French drain can significantly reduce these issues by providing a clear pathway for water to escape, preventing it from accumulating around the foundation or in other vulnerable spots. This service can be especially effective in areas prone to heavy rainfall or with uneven terrain that directs water toward the home.

The overview below groups typical French Drain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Temperance, MI.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- For minor French drain fixes or repairs,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, depending on the extent of the work and site conditions.
Standard Installation - Installing a new French drain system for typical residential properties usually costs between $1,200 and $3,000. Most projects in this category are straightforward and fall into the middle of this range.
Full System Replacement - Replacing an existing French drain or installing a comprehensive drainage system can range from $3,500 to $6,000 or more. Larger, more complex projects tend to reach the higher end of this spectrum.
Complex or Custom Projects - Highly customized or extensive drainage solutions, such as those involving multiple zones or challenging terrain, can exceed $6,000 and may reach $10,000+ in some cases. These projects are less common but typically involve specialized work by experienced local contractors.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is a French drain and how does it work? A French drain is a trench filled with gravel or rock that redirects surface water and groundwater away from a property. It typically includes a perforated pipe that channels water efficiently to prevent pooling and flooding.
What are common signs that a French drain might be needed? Signs include persistent basement dampness, water pooling around the foundation, or soggy yard areas after heavy rain, indicating drainage issues that a French drain can address.
How do local contractors install French drains? Contractors typically excavate a trench along the problem area, lay a perforated pipe, cover it with gravel, and backfill with soil, ensuring proper slope for effective water flow.
Can a French drain be installed around existing landscaping? Yes, many service providers can incorporate French drains into existing landscapes, often by carefully excavating and integrating the system without disrupting existing features.
What maintenance is required for a French drain system? Regular inspections to remove debris and ensure the pipe remains unobstructed are recommended to maintain optimal drainage performance.
